Amazon Warehouse Workers Continue to Push for Unionization
Posted On: Jan 08, 2019
Jan. 8, 2019 | ORGANIZING |  As Amazon’s workforce has more than doubled over the past three years, workers at Amazon fulfillment center warehouses in the United States have started organizing and pushing toward forming a union to fight back against the company’s treatment of its workers… “Amazon is a very big company. They need to have a union put in place,” said an Amazon worker who requested to remain anonymous. The worker has been with the company for two years and was transferred to Staten Island when it opened in October 2018. “They overwork you and you’re like a number to them. During peak season and Prime season, they give you 60 hours a week.” …Amazon fulfillment centers aren’t the only part of Amazon where workers started organizing efforts in 2018… The Guardian
